Output e1c7efa750a4a680d7e3f4bdb393bb8f7e3eb60ccb65fd92614dfccb33b4ff83:1

value
435128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3c437f81b800e96d3136aa485e5f4b72ef950c OP_EQUAL
address
32tzuEKAbsNtPkuBbzKa6YNQG6E1kmQiYu
transaction
e1c7efa750a4a680d7e3f4bdb393bb8f7e3eb60ccb65fd92614dfccb33b4ff83
confirmations
196315
spent
true